ABSTRACT

This chapter deals with the works and operations, relating to the electronic communications operated by code operators, for which there are permitted development rights under the 2015 Order, as it applies to England. It addresses Class A, which makes provision for permitted development rights for electronic code operators. The permitted development is development by or on behalf of an electronic communications code operator for the purpose of the operator's electronic communications network in, on, over or under land controlled by that operator or in accordance with the electronic communications code. Article 4 directions may be found in such locations as conservation areas, national parks and areas of outstanding natural beauty.
